Rain likely across country, temperatures to remain steady

BSS
Published On: 04 May 2025, 12:45

DHAKA, May 04, 2025 (BSS) - Rain or thundershowers accompanied by lightning and temporary gusty wind are likely to occur at a few places over Rangpur, Rajshahi and Sylhet divisions and at one or two places over Dhaka, Mymensingh, Khulna, Barishal and Chattogram divisions.

The Bangladesh Meteorological Department (BMD) forecast this in a release valid for 120 hours starting at 9:00am today. 

According to the forecast, the day and night temperatures across the country are expected to may remain nearly unchanged. 

Meanwhile, rainfall activity may decrease and the day and night temperatures could see a slight increase, according to the outlook for next five days.
 
The maximum temperature recorded on Saturday was 36.6 degrees Celsius at Baghabari under Rajshahi division, while the minimum temperature today was 21.5 degrees Celsius at Dimla under Rangpur division.

In Dhaka, the sun will set today at 6:29pm and rise tomorrow at 5:22am.
